Creating Pinot segments
Pinot segments can be created offline on Hadoop, or via command line from data files. Controller REST endpoint can then be used to add the segment to the table to which the segment belongs. Pinot segments can also be created by ingesting data from realtime resources (such as Kafka).

Creating Pinot segments outside of Hadoop
Here is how you can create Pinot segments from standard formats like CSV/JSON/AVRO.
Follow the steps described in the section on to build pinot. Locate pinot-admin.sh in pinot-tools/target/pinot-tools=pkg/bin/pinot-admin.sh.
Create a top level directory containing all the CSV/JSON/AVRO files that need to be converted into segments.
Run the pinot-admin command to generate the segments. The command can be invoked as follows. Options within “[ ]” are optional. For -format, the default value is AVRO.
To configure various parameters for CSV a config file in JSON format can be provided. This file is optional, as are each of its parameters. When not provided, default values used for these parameters are described below:

Pushing offline segments to Pinot
You can use curl to push a segment to pinot:
Alternatively you can use the pinot-admin.sh utility to upload one or more segments:
The command uploads all the segments found in segmentDirectoryPath. The segments could be either tar-compressed (in which case it is a file under segmentDirectoryPath) or uncompressed (in which case it is a directory under segmentDirectoryPath).
